- The text discusses the discovery of small-molecule activators for p21-activated kinase-1 (PAK1), a regulator of cardiac homeostasis.
- A rational peptide-guided strategy was used to target PAK1's autoinhibitory regulation, identifying a new autoinhibition-release site.
- High-throughput screening and medicinal chemistry led to selective allosteric activators with micromolar potency and isoform specificity.
- Structural studies show these activators disrupt autoinhibition and promote conformational changes to an active state.
- Enhanced PAK1 signaling was confirmed in cardiac cells, and in vivo studies showed efficacy in treating cardiac hypertrophy.
- The findings propose modulating kinase autoinhibitory regulation as a strategy for developing kinase activators, an underexplored therapeutic area.
